Types of Handlebar Extensions
There are several types out there, and I had to figure out which style suited my bike and riding style:
- Clip-On Extensions: These clamp onto your existing handlebars. They’re easy to install and remove, which I appreciated for occasional use.
- Bar Ends: These are installed at the ends of flat or riser bars. I found them great for mountain biking since they give extra leverage.
- Aerobar Extensions: Ideal for road biking or triathlons, these let you adopt a more aerodynamic position.
Knowing what type fits your bike and riding style is key.
Material and Build Quality
I looked for extensions made from lightweight but durable materials like aluminum or carbon fiber. Aluminum extensions were more budget-friendly for me and still sturdy. Carbon fiber options are lighter but usually pricier. Whichever you choose, make sure they can support your weight and riding style without flexing too much.
Compatibility With My Handlebars
Not all extensions fit every handlebar size or shape. I checked the diameter of my handlebars (usually 22.2mm for mountain bikes and 23.8mm or 31.8mm for road bikes) and made sure the extensions matched. Also, consider the shape of your bars—extensions designed for flat bars won’t fit drop bars.
Comfort and Ergonomics
I tested different extensions to see how they felt in various hand positions. Some had ergonomic grips or padding, which helped reduce hand numbness on long rides. The angle and length of the extensions also affected comfort, so I picked ones that allowed a natural wrist position.
Installation and Adjustability
I preferred extensions that were easy to install with basic tools. Some models offer adjustable angles or sliding positions, which is great for customizing fit. I recommend choosing adjustable extensions if you want to experiment with hand placement before settling on your favorite position.
Weight Considerations
If you’re concerned about keeping your bike light, pay attention to the weight of the extensions. For me, the small added weight was worth the comfort and control benefits, but if you’re racing, you might want the lightest option possible.
Price vs. Value
Prices vary widely, so I set a budget but also looked at user reviews to ensure quality. Sometimes spending a bit more upfront saved me from having to replace cheap extensions later. Think about how often and how far you ride to decide how much to invest.
